0.01/0.02 No-Limit Hold'em (9 handed)
Hand recorder used for this poker hand: PokerStrategy.com Elephant 0.105 by www.pokerstrategy.com.

Preflop: Hero is UTG1 with Q♠, Q♣
Hero raises to $0.08, 5 folds, BU calls $0.08, 2 folds.

Flop: ($0.19) J♦, 6♥, 3♦ (2 players)
Hero bets $0.12, BU raises to $0.44, Hero raises to $2.22 (All-In)
During this hand I was remembering example 22 from how to play after the flop. ( http://www.pokerstrategy.com/strategy/bss/1565/2/ ) Was this the correct implimentation? I was happy to pursue this line because villain was rather loose and aggressive.

Hello lynius,

Against that kind of loose maniac we are not folding our hand here. He could easily have draws/weaker PPs/pairs. Although myself I would just CB it ~$0,16.
